Ucluelet is a rugged and incredibly scenic coastal community located on the western edge of Vancouver Island in British Columbia. Often considered the quieter, more relaxed neighbor to nearby Tofino, Ucluelet sits on a striking peninsula surrounded by the crashing waves of the Pacific Ocean and the calm waters of Barkley Sound. It is a premier destination for those looking to experience the raw, untamed beauty of Canada's west coast, featuring ancient temperate rainforests and dramatic rocky shorelines. The crown jewel of the area is the Wild Pacific Trail, a spectacular coastal pathway that winds past the historic Amphitrite Point Lighthouse and features unparalleled views of the turbulent ocean. During the winter months, Ucluelet becomes a famous spot for storm watching, where visitors can safely observe massive Pacific swells crashing against the cliffs. In the summer, the sheltered waters of Barkley Sound are first-rate for kayaking, wildlife tours, and world-class salmon and halibut fishing. The town serves as a southern gateway to the Pacific Rim National Park Reserve, featuring endless sandy beaches and ancient cedar trees. Local restaurants excel at serving fresh, sustainably caught seafood in a laid-back atmosphere. Accessible via a sweeping drive across Vancouver Island from Nanaimo, Ucluelet gives a deeply immersive coastal retreat any time of the year.

Sights in the town Ucluelet (7)

Thornton Creek Hatchery📍 landmark

Salmon hatchery on Thornton Creek, releasing juvenile coho and chinook into the Pacific watershed.

🕒 Mo-Fr 10:00-15:00

Big Beach🎡 recreation

Wide sandy beach on the Pacific coast of Ucluelet, known for storm-watching and sea stacks.

Crow's nest🌿 nature

High rocky viewpoint on the Wild Pacific Trail, offering panoramic views of the Pacific Ocean and coastline.

Wild Pacific Trail📍 landmark

Wild Pacific Trail is a coastal hiking path with dramatic Pacific views along Vancouver Island's rugged shoreline.

Wild Pacific Trail - Lighthouse Loop📍 landmark

Lighthouse Loop passes the historic Amphitrite Point Lighthouse with spectacular ocean vistas.

Little Beach🎡 recreation

Little Beach is a small sandy cove in Ucluelet, first-rate for relaxing and beachcombing.

He-Tin-Kis🎡 recreation

He-Tin-Kis is a secluded sandy beach on the Pacific, surrounded by dense rainforest.
